The Role of Human Transcription
While AI is powerful, human transcription still has an important role. Some recordings have background noise, overlapping speakers, strong accents, technical language or sensitive subject matter. In these cases, human review can raise accuracy and ensure the final transcript reads naturally. Human editors can fix misheard words, format speaker labels, refine punctuation and clarify unclear sections when possible.
The best approach often blends automation with human quality control. AI creates the first version quickly, while human review refines the final document for accuracy and flow. This hybrid method works well for legal discussions, medical interviews, academic research, corporate meetings, media publishing and professional subtitles where accuracy matters. It also helps users balance speed, cost and reliability.

Spanish and Dutch Transcription and Translation Workflows
Language-specific transcription and translation require attention to detail. Spanish recordings can include regional pronunciation, fast speech, informal expressions or mixed-language phrases. Dutch recordings may include industry terms, names, place references or speaker variation. A strong workflow should identify the source language correctly, produce a readable transcript and then support translation into clear English.
The keyword spanish to english transciption often reflects a common need: turning Spanish speech into an English text output. In practice, this may involve transcription first, translation second and editing last. This layered process helps maintain meaning while improving readability. For business, academic and media use, a clean final document is often more useful than a literal word-by-word conversion.
How to Choose the Right Transcription Workflow
The right transcription method depends on the purpose of the file. For quick notes, AI-only transcription may be enough. For publication, research or formal records, human review may be better. For multilingual projects, transcription and translation should be handled carefully so the meaning is not lost. Users should also consider audio quality, speaker count, accents, file length, turnaround expectations and privacy needs.
A good workflow should make editing simple. Even accurate transcripts can need paragraph breaks, speaker names, timestamps or cleaned-up formatting. For content teams, the final transcript should be easy to turn into blogs, captions, summaries or reports. For business teams, it should be clear enough to support decisions, records and later reference.
